How Video Surveillance Systems Keep Businesses Secure Anytime, Anywhere

In the ever-evolving landscape of business security, the role of video surveillance systems has undergone a remarkable transformation. As businesses prioritize robust security measures, remote video surveillance has emerged as a game-changer, providing the capability to keep businesses secure anytime, anywhere.

The Evolution of Video Surveillance Systems

From traditional closed-circuit television (CCTV) to modern IP-based systems, the evolution of video surveillance technology has been nothing short of revolutionary. Advances in camera technology and connectivity have paved the way for more sophisticated and effective remote monitoring, significantly enhancing the security landscape for businesses.

The Components of Remote Video Surveillance

The backbone of remote video surveillance lies in its key components. High-definition cameras with superior image clarity, network connectivity, and cloud-based storage contribute to creating a robust system. The ability to access and monitor video feeds remotely in real-time adds a layer of flexibility and responsiveness to security measures.

Ensuring Privacy and Compliance

Addressing concerns related to privacy and data protection is paramount in the era of remote video surveillance. Implementing encryption and secure access protocols ensures that businesses adhere to legal regulations and compliance standards. Striking the right balance between security and privacy is crucial for the successful implementation of these systems.

Remote Video Surveillance for Various Industries

The versatility of remote video surveillance like Qumulex makes it applicable across various industries. In retail, it aids in loss prevention, while in manufacturing and warehouses, it optimizes operational efficiency. Corporate environments benefit from enhanced office security, and critical infrastructure relies on it for safeguarding sensitive facilities.

Integration with Other Security Measures

The synergy between remote video surveillance and other security measures is a key aspect of its effectiveness. Combining video surveillance with access control systems creates a comprehensive security framework. Additionally, the integration with physical security personnel and cybersecurity measures ensures holistic protection.

The Role of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Remote Monitoring

Artificial Intelligence (AI) plays a pivotal role in elevating remote video surveillance to new heights. AI-driven analytics enable proactive threat detection, automated alerts, and real-time response capabilities. Anticipated advancements in AI integration promise even more sophisticated features for video surveillance systems.
